Description
USN-5606-1 fixed a vulnerability in poppler. Unfortunately it was missing a commit to fix it properly. This update provides the corresponding fix for Ubuntu 18.04 LTS and Ubuntu 16.04 ESM.
We apologize for the inconvenience.
Original advisory details:
It was discovered that poppler incorrectly handled certain PDF. An attacker could possibly use this issue to cause a denial of service or execute arbitrary code.
